Lactated Ringer’s injection is used to replace water and electrolyte loss in patients with low blood volume or low blood pressure.
WebIn patients older than 28 days (including adults), ceftriaxone must not be administered simultaneously with intravenous calcium-containing solutions, including Lactated Ringer's Injection, through the same infusion line (e.g., via Y … WebPrecipitation of ceftriaxone-calcium can occur when ceftriaxone is mixed with calcium-containing solutions, such as Lactated Ringer’s Injection USP, in the same intravenous administration line. Do not administer ceftriaxone simultaneously with Lactated Ringer’s Injection USP via a Y-site. However, in patients other than neonates ...
